WebFeb 3, 2024 · 4. Receive a certificate from the state. The state will issue you a certificate that confirms the LLC formally exists after the LLC's formation documents are filed and approved. This certificate will allow the LLC to obtain an Employer Identification Number (EIN), business licenses, and business bank account. 5. Web3. File Formation Paperwork. If you’re a sole proprietor or general partnership, you don’t need to file formation paperwork with the Secretary of State because you and your business are one and the same. However, if you want to start a Texas LLC or corporation, you must file paperwork with the Secretary of State.
